WebEven after heat molding, the liner will still stretch and compress for the first 4 to 5 days of use. So, it is important to be kind to your feet for the first few days of skiing in your new boots. Here is what you need to do. First, plan what to wear. You want thin ski socks, and they must be socks actually designed for skiing.
